
詳解PHP協(xié)程:Go + Chan + Defer
PHP 協(xié)程:Go + Chan + Defer Swoole4為PHP語(yǔ)言提供了強(qiáng)大的CSP協(xié)程編程模式。底層提供了3個(gè)關(guān)鍵詞,可以方便地實(shí)現(xiàn)各類功能。 Swoole4提供的PHP協(xié)程語(yǔ)法借鑒自Golang,在此向GO開(kāi)發(fā)組致敬 PHP+...
PHP 協(xié)程:Go + Chan + Defer Swoole4為PHP語(yǔ)言提供了強(qiáng)大的CSP協(xié)程編程模式。底層提供了3個(gè)關(guān)鍵詞,可以方便地實(shí)現(xiàn)各類功能。 Swoole4提供的PHP協(xié)程語(yǔ)法借鑒自Golang,在此向GO開(kāi)發(fā)組致敬 PHP+...
在日常開(kāi)發(fā)過(guò)程中,你可能會(huì)遇到并發(fā)控制的場(chǎng)景,比如控制請(qǐng)求并發(fā)數(shù)。那么在 JavaScript 中如何實(shí)現(xiàn)并發(fā)控制呢?在回答這個(gè)問(wèn)題之前,我們來(lái)簡(jiǎn)單介紹一下并發(fā)控制。 假設(shè)有 6 個(gè)待辦任務(wù)要執(zhí)行,而我們希望限制同時(shí)執(zhí)行的任務(wù)個(gè)數(shù),即最多只...
javascript傳參數(shù)的方法:首先創(chuàng)建一個(gè)相應(yīng)的js文件;然后通過(guò)“function alertInfo(name, age, home, friend) {…}”實(shí)現(xiàn)傳參即可。 本文操作環(huán)境:windows7系統(tǒng)、java...
JavaScript繼承的實(shí)現(xiàn)方法:1、利用構(gòu)造原型模式;2、使用動(dòng)態(tài)原型,根據(jù)面向?qū)ο蟮脑O(shè)計(jì)原則,類型的所有成員應(yīng)該都被封裝在類結(jié)構(gòu)體內(nèi);3、使用工廠模式;4、使用類繼承,即在子類中調(diào)用父類構(gòu)造函數(shù)。 本教程操作環(huán)境:windows7系統(tǒng)...
方法:1、使用雙引號(hào)或單引號(hào)包含任意長(zhǎng)度的文本,例“"true"”;2、使用String()類型函數(shù)構(gòu)造字符串,語(yǔ)法“new String("值")”;3、使用fromCharCode()方法把字符編...
裝飾器模式允許向一個(gè)現(xiàn)有的對(duì)象添加新的功能,同時(shí)又不改變其結(jié)構(gòu)。本篇文章帶大家了解PHP中的裝飾器模式,介紹一下裝飾器的好處以及最適用于的場(chǎng)景。 工廠模式告一段落,我們來(lái)研究其他一些模式。不知道各位大佬有沒(méi)有嘗試過(guò)女裝?據(jù)說(shuō)女裝大佬程序員很...
JavaScript可以做很多出色的事情,本篇文章給大家整理50+個(gè)實(shí)用工具函數(shù),可以幫助你提高工作效率并可以幫助調(diào)試代碼?。?1、isStatic: 檢測(cè)數(shù)據(jù)是不是除了symbol外的原始數(shù)據(jù)。 function isStatic(val...
javascript實(shí)現(xiàn)繼承的方式:1、原型鏈繼承;將父類的實(shí)例作為子類的原型。2、構(gòu)造繼承;使用父類的構(gòu)造函數(shù)來(lái)增強(qiáng)子類實(shí)例。3、實(shí)例繼承;為父類實(shí)例添加新特性,作為子類實(shí)例返回。4、拷貝繼承。5、組合繼承。6、寄生組合繼承。 本教程操作...
今天thinkphp框架欄目給大家?guī)?lái)的主題就是“Thinkphp5之Workerman”,下面我們來(lái)詳細(xì)介紹~ 好了,開(kāi)始今天的主題內(nèi)容:tp5的workerman 1.使用composer下載tp5 a) 使用中國(guó)鏡像(任何環(huán)境都可用)...
在php中,Git是一個(gè)開(kāi)源的分布式版本控制系統(tǒng),是一個(gè)版本管理工具,可以有效、高速地處理從很小到非常大的項(xiàng)目版本管理;它是編程人員常用的重要工具,可以很大程度上提高項(xiàng)目工作的效率。 本教程操作環(huán)境:windows7系統(tǒng)、PHP7.1版,D...